‘Anbarābād geodata
‘Anbarābād (Kerman) is a seat of a second-order administrative division; located in Iran in Asia/Tehran (GMT+3.5) time zone. In our database, there are 232 cities with bigger population. Compared to other cities in Iran, 91.2% of cities are located further ↑North; 87.1% of cities are located further ←West and 71.7% of cities have higher elevation than ‘Anbarābād. Note1

Elevation
Elevation of ‘Anbarābād is 603 m = 1978 ft, and this is 446 m = 1463 ft below average elevation for this country.

Geographical zone
‘Anbarābād is located in North temperate zone (between Tropic of Cancer and the Arctic Circle). Distance of this Northern Tropic circle is 560.3 km =348.2 mi to South.| Distance of | km | miles | from ‘Anbarābād |
